Decorative pediment fronton

A decorative pediment fronton is a triangular or arched architectural crowning element positioned above door frames, window openings, and main building entrances. Frequently specified in classical and neoclassical architecture for villas, residential manors, and hotels to impart a grand aesthetic. Manufactured from high-density polyurethane raw material, these pediments add zero structural load due to their lightweight properties. Featuring superior resistance against rain, snow, UV fading, and moisture, they will not rot or decay. Firmly anchored to wall surfaces using screws and specialized adhesives. Easily painted with exterior-grade acrylic or silicone paints.
